What is the theme of St Lucy’s Home for Girls raised by Wolves?

English
1 answer:
Naddik [55]3 years ago
6 0
One of the themes

is change is not always a good thing because the from the beginning of the story, the girls are being told to change into civilized human beings and forget all of their tradition and natural wolf instincts. They are being told to change who they are.
